SEAM是一种常见的域名和网络资产枚举工具,在网络安全和信息收集领域应用广泛。通过SEAM工具可以查询、挖掘并整理出与特定目标相关联的域名网站。这一过程对于企业资产管理、漏洞检测、风险评估以及红蓝对抗等场景都具有极高的参考价值。本文将介绍SEAM的基本原理、实际应用与操作方法,并分析其所查询到的域名网站在网络安全中的意义。在当今互联网安全领域,信息收集与资产识别是渗透测试和防御工作的基石。SEAM是众多安全从业者与研究人员常用的一种子域名自动化枚举工具,其通过对公开数据源的爬取、解析和归类,能够较为完整地枚举出目标组织所拥有的全部域名和站点,助力资产识别与风险评估。
一、SEAM工具简述
SEAM(Subdomain Enumeration And Mapping)并不是单一一种工具的正式名称,而更像是子域名枚举与映射这一技术方向的简称。现在广泛使用的相关工具有Amass、Sublist3r、OneForAll等,它们共同特点是通过多源数据自动化收集与整理相关域名。SEAM类工具广泛整合DNS记录分析、公开子域名泄漏、证书透明日志、搜索引擎反查、网络爬虫等多种技术,生成一份目标站点相关的域名资产清单。
二、域名网站的查询与意义
通过SEAM工具进行扫描,一般可以查询到如下类型的域名网站:
1. 目标公司的主域名(如example.com);
2. 历史遗留或测试环境子域名(如test.example.com、old.example.com);
3. 可能并未公开但注册过SSL证书的匿名服务(如vpn.example.com);
4. 利用CDN或云服务部署的独立子站点(如cdn.example.com);
5. 存在于第三方合作平台下的联合子域名(如partner.example.com);
6. 被劫持或外泄的高危域名入口。
这些域名的查询结果极大丰富了攻击面信息。例如测试环境、后台管理系统、历史站点,常因上线标准不足或维护疏忽,成为攻击者的重点目标。企业内部常常低估其子域名暴露的风险,而SEAM则能有效地揭示潜在风险。
三、操作流程简要
以Amass为例,常见的操作过程为:
1. 收集域名基本信息:`amass enum -d example.com -o output.txt`
2. 结果分析与资产梳理
3. 利用其它安全工具对查询到的域名进行探测,如端口扫描、敏感目录扫描、漏洞检查等。
四、应用场景和安全意义
企业安全团队可以定期利用SEAM工具对本组织进行全面的资产梳理,将未管理的、已暴露的域名网站纳入统一管理,及时关闭或加固高危入口。红队演练时通常借助SEAM收集情报,规划攻击路径。安全研究员通过此类工具还可发现互联网大型企业隐蔽站点,有助于白帽预警与漏洞防护。
五、合法合规提醒
最后需要强调的是,SEAM及相关域名枚举工具仅应在授权情况下、合法合规前提下使用。对于企业自身资产自测是极佳选择,若用于非法攻击或未经授权操作则属于法律禁止的行为。
总的来说,SEAM技术已经成为网络空间资产探测和域名安全风险识别的利器。对于任何关注网络安全的人士而言,了解和掌握这项技术都是必不可少的基础能力。
评论 ( 0 )